One of the key benefits of Xin Wang Drainage Geocomposites is their ability to effectively manage water flow. These geocomposites are designed with a high-density polyethylene (HDPE) core that provides excellent drainage capabilities. The core is surrounded by a non-woven geotextile fabric that acts as a filter, allowing water to pass through while preventing soil particles from clogging the drainage system. This ensures that excess water is efficiently drained away from the soil, reducing the risk of waterlogging and soil erosion.

Xin Wang Drainage Geocomposites are made up of a combination of geotextiles and drainage cores. The geotextiles act as a filter, allowing water to pass through while preventing soil particles from clogging the drainage cores. This ensures that the drainage system remains effective over time, even in areas with high soil erosion rates. The drainage cores, on the other hand, provide a pathway for water to flow away from the soil, preventing it from accumulating and causing damage.
